Two thieves lynched in Medan
MEDAN, North Sumatra: Two thieves caught red-handed in a house
in Percut Sei Tuan in the city were mobbed to death on Friday.
The two were dealt rough justice by hundreds of people after
Adi Purnomo, owner of the house, shouted for help early in the
morning on Friday.
Purnomo suffered light injuries in a physical clash with the
two thieves who tried to escape but who, later, were apprehended
by the crowd.
Two policemen present at the site could not disperse
the mob as many residents had lost electronic goods, motorcycles
and clothes over the last few months.
The police took the thieves' bodies to the Pringadi General
Hospital while making no arrest of the mob. --Antara
